Bandwidth throttled to 90mbs every day
Bandwidth throttled to 90mbs every day
I have 2 X50s that I've had for a couple of years and they were brilliant for over 18 months... but lately, every morning I get up, I can only get 90mbs download and about 3mbs upload.
I normally get 960/100.
This happens on all my devices (Windows, osx and iOS) so it's not a device thing.
if I reboot the Decos, it goes back to 960/100.
if I connect to my main routers wifi it's at full speed too (before rebooting the Decos)... so the incoming speed is fine.
ive seen lots of other posts about similar thing happening to others... so its got to be problem with an update we received at some point as it worked fine for 18 months and nothing else has changed on my setup.
Has anyone got any suggestions on what's happening and how to stop it happening please?
